NEW YORK, April 9 (UPI) -- A body modification artist in Phoenix says he can perform cosmetic surgery on ears to give them a pointy, Dr. Spock-like appearance.

It will cost you $600 for the non-reversible surgery, which if performed by Phoenix artist Steve Haworth must be done with no anesthesia because he is not licensed to practice medicine, the New York Daily News reported.

"There's a lot of people out there who have an inner vision of themselves and they want to express that to the world around them," Haworth told ABC News. "I'm very happy to be an artist that can provide that kind of work."

The procedure involves cutting open the tips of the ear and sculpting the cartilage into elf points. Besides being painful, the procedure can cause other problems.

Some doctors say cartilage sculpting can cause ear deformities and dangerous infections that can destroy ears within a few days.

The concerns weren't enough to keep Jordan Houtz from having the procedure. She said she had been thinking about having it done for 18 months.

"It just fits my personality," Houtz said.
